NEW DELHI, July 4: Auto sector demand in India remained resilient in June, with personal mobility segments continuing to outperform, a report has said.
The report from Asit C Mehta Investment Intermediates said easing of supply-side bottlenecks at several OEMs, healthy retail demand and sustained export momentum supported volume growth during June.
Export momentum for two- and three-wheelers is also expected to remain supportive, the report added.Two-wheeler YoY retail growth rate accelerated across all players for June, compared to slightly slower traction seen in May 2026, while wholesale growth was mixed across OEMs
“June 2026 remained another healthy month for the domestic auto industry, with demand holding up well across all segments despite macro and geopolitical risks and price hikes,” the brokerage said.
Retail demand was supported by healthy consumer sentiment, while exports maintained strong momentum across most OEMs.”Overall, demand remained resilient despite concerns around fuel prices, inflationary pressures and monsoon uncertainty,” it noted.Cumulative domestic two‑wheeler sales grew 22 per cent year‑on‑year to 33.6 lakh units in April–June 2026.
